getInsights static method

void getInsights(
  1. int insights,
  2. AdInsight? previousInsight,
  3. dynamic callback(
    1. Insights
    ), [
  4. int timeoutInSeconds = 0,
])

Implementation

static void getInsights(int insights, AdInsight? previousInsight, Function(Insights) callback, [int timeoutInSeconds=0]) {
  _callbackRegistry[_requestId] = callback;
  int previousAdOpportunity = -1;
  if (previousInsight != null) {
    previousAdOpportunity = previousInsight.adOpportunityId;
  }
  _methodChannel.invokeMapMethod('getInsights', {
    "requestId": _requestId,
    "adOpportunityId": previousAdOpportunity,
    "insights": insights,
    "timeout": timeoutInSeconds
  });
  _requestId++;
}